#2138d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2138d1 is composed of 12.9% red, 22%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.2% cyan, 73.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 232.2 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 47.5%. #2138d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#4270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2138d1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010206 is the darkest color, while #f4f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2138d1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#75767d is the less saturated color, while #0523ed is the most saturated one.
